Tips and useful information to better organise your trip to the city of Vienna
Vienna, the beautiful European city most commonly associated with the Waltz and with elegance, is undoubtedly enchanting. Its imperial history can be felt through the architectural style of the city: baroque buildings and nostalgic castles and you can understand why many of the brilliant minds of the 1900s (Freud, Musil, Schnietzller, Schiele, Klimt, Strauss and many others) chose this city as their home

What to see in Vienna
The Ring, a great way to get an overview of the entire historical centre of Vienna on foot and get a glimpse of the most important and famous buildings the city has to offer. Stephansdom (St. Stephen's cathedral), a splendid gothic cathedral with a decorated spiral that is 137m tall – walk up 343 steps to the top for a magnificent view of the city!The Vienna Prater amusement park, with its famous ferrace wheel. The Spanish Equitation School in Vienna, home of classic equitation for over 400 years.
Schönbrunn Palace, residence of the imperial family.
